ГОСТ Р ИСО 10303-59—2012
WR2: Все объекты, играющие роль атрибута inspected_elements во всех экземплярах объекта
shapo_data_quality_inspection_instance_report_item. связанных с настоящим объектом, должны быть
объектами типа closed_sholl.
WR3: Во всех объектах instance_report_item_with_extreme_instances, связанных с настоящим
объектом, во всехобъектах типа extremeJnstance. на которые ссылается объект instance_report_ item_
with_oxtromeJnstances. объекты, на которые ссылается атрибут locations_of_extreme_value. должны
бытьобъектами типа edge_curve.
WR4: Настоящий объект не должен бытьсвязан посредством объектов shape_data_quality_ criterion_
and_accuracy_association ни с какими элементами данных, задающими точность. Объект shape_data_
quality_inspection_result. соответствующий настоящему объекту, также не должен быть связан посред
ством объекта shape_inspection_result_accuracy_association с какими-либо элементами данных, задаю
щими точность.
7.4.17 Объект inconsistent_adjacent_faco_normals
Объект inconsistent_adjacont_face_normals представляет утверждение, что в незамкнутой оболоч
ке, представленной объектом opon_shell. или в замкнутой оболочке, представленной объектом closed_sholl,
две грани, представленные объектами face, которые совместно используют одно ребро,
представленное объектом edge, имеют несогласованные нормали. Согласно требованию к измерению,
оответствующему данному объекту, необходимо, чтобы была проведена проверка ориентации всех
ребер, представленных объектами odge. относящихся к граням незамкнутой оболочки, представленной
объектом open_shell. или замкнутой оболочки, представленной объектом closod_shell. Если две
смежные грани используют общее ребро с одинаковой ориентацией, то топологические нормали граней
имеют противоположные направления и. следовательно, нормали граней не согласованы.
П р и м е ч а н и е — На рисунке 5 ребро, представленное объектом edge, совместно используется двумя
представленными объектами face гранями, гранью 1 и гранью 2, с совпадающей ориентацией. Следовательно,
топологические нормали двух граней имеют противоположные направления.
Рисунок 5 — Несогласованные топологические нормали смежных граней
EXPRESS-специФикация:
•)
ENTITY inconsjstent_adjacent_faco_normals
SUBTYPE OF(erroneous_topok>gy);
SELF\shape_data_quality_criterion.assessment_spGCification:
shape_data_quality_assessment_by_logical_test;
WHERE
WR1: validate_measured_data_type(SELF,
’SHAPE_DATA_QUALITY_!NSPECTION_RESULT_SCHEMA.BOOLEAN_VALUE’);
W R2: validate_inspected_olements_type(SELF,
rSHAPE_DATA_QUALITY_INSPECTION_RESULT_SCHEMA>
32